What temperature is too high for MacBook Air?

Your MacBook has an ideal range of operating temperatures — Apple recommends a range between 50 to 95 degrees Fahrenheit . If you work in direct sunlight or in a space that’s very hot, it can cause your MacBook to overheat.

What is a good battery temperature MacBook Air?

Operating temperature: 50° to 95° F (10° to 35° C)

What happens if my MacBook air gets too cold?

Be especially careful if you live in a cold place that is also humid. Bringing a freezing cold MacBook Pro into a warmer, humid environment can cause immediate condensation on the internal components of the device. This, in turn, could cause unintended water damage to your MacBook Pro.

Can you overcharge a MacBook Pro 2020?

You can run your Mac on battery for a little bit, then charge it back up to whatever level you want, and repeat this as many times as you want. In short, you can use your battery any way you want to. You can leave the charger connected all the time if you want to. The computer will not overcharge.

Why are Macs so cold?

When you touch the metal of the Macbook Pro, heat transfers from your body to the Macbook Pro much more quickly than it would to something like plastic. You perceive the Macbook Pro to be “cold.” In actuality, you are perceiving the rate of heat transfer, rather than the temperature of the Macbook Pro.

Is cold bad for Macbook Air?

Since the screen actually has fluid in it, too cold can damage it. As seen on the stated specs: Operating temperature: 50° to 95° F (10° to 35° C) Storage temperature: -13° to 113° F (-24° to 45° C)
